(a) 
Integration costs represent external, incremental costs directly related to integrating acquired businesses and primarily include expenditures for consulting and the integration of systems and processes, as well as product transfer costs.
(b) 
The restructuring charges/(reversals) for the three months ended March 31, 2018, primarily relate to the supply network strategy.
The restructuring charges/(reversals) for the three months ended April 2, 2017, primarily relate to the operational efficiency initiative.
(c) 
The restructuring charges/(reversals) are associated with the following:
For the three months ended March 31, 2018, Manufacturing/research/corporate ($1 million).
For the three months ended April 2, 2017, U.S. ($1 million) and International ($2 million reversal)
